Skip to content

Revert to Markdown

Revert to Markdown #12

Workflow file for this run

# alternative ruby implementation
name: serpapi-ruby-alternative
on:
push:
branches: [ master ]
pull_request:
branches: [ master ]
jobs:
test:
runs-on: ubuntu-latest
strategy:
matrix:
# 'truffleruby' - git action is broken - april 2023
# 'truffleruby+graalvm - git action is broken - april 2023
ruby-version: [ 'jruby']
steps:
- uses: actions/checkout@v3
- name: Set up Ruby ${{ matrix.ruby-version }}
uses: ruby/setup-ruby@359bebbc29cbe6c87da6bc9ea3bc930432750108
with:
ruby-version: ${{ matrix.ruby-version }}
- name: demo
env:
API_KEY: ${{ secrets.API_KEY }}
run: |
gem build serpapi.gemspec
gem install ./serpapi-*.gem
ruby oobt/demo.rb